SKETCHES OF LOU
by Lisa Blatter
synopsis
Lou is a restless city nomad. In her constant search for freedom, the twentysomething has long suppressed what it is she is actually running from. Devoid of a permanent home and intent on travelling abroad, she meets Aro – who is different. Lou and Aro involuntarily affect each other more deeply than either expected. Without noticing it, Lou suddenly has expectations and feelings of jealousy, emotions that contradict her longing for independence. For Lou, this marks the beginning of an internal emotional conflict that takes her on a journey into her own past, from the melting pot of a summer in Zurich to the cool serenity of a glacier landscape.
